Conflict of Interest
As he's the one bearing the brunt of Des's temper, Reg Hollis wonders if Taviner's stress leave helped at all. But for a moment Taviner's mood does lift when he spots new PC Gemma Osbourne. Called out to a residents' dispute, Des and Reg discover that a local teenage tearaway, Andy Bennett, is running rings around the police and the local residents. But with Des on his case his luck might change. Acting DI Samantha Nixon is finding it hard to concentrate on her job as her mind is on the serial killer case. MIT receives a letter from the supposed killer saying he has struck again, and Samantha can't hide her frustration at not being part of the team. Will her determination to prove Baxter's guilt lead her too far out on a limb, or will her risky behaviour pay off? Insp. Gold visits Debbie McAllister in hospital to bring her Tom's things, while back at the office, Jack Meadows and Mickey Webb make up, but Debbie is not about to forgive and forget.
